Summaryinfo

A vulnerability labeled as critical has been found in Microsoft Internet Explorer up to 6. This impacts an unknown function of the component HTA Handler. Executing a manipulation can lead to memory corruption. This vulnerability is registered as CVE-2006-1388.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. No exploit is available. It is suggested to use an alternative component instead of the affected one.

Detailsinfo

A vulnerability has been found in Microsoft Internet Explorer up to 6 (Web Browser) and classified as critical. This vulnerability affects an unknown part of the component HTA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

Unspecified vulnerability in Microsoft Internet Explorer 6.0 allows remote attackers to execute HTA files via unknown vectors.

The weakness was published 03/27/2006 by Jeffrey van der Stad as MS06-013 (Website). The advisory is available at jeffrey.vanderstad.net. This vulnerability was named CVE-2006-1388 since 03/24/2006. The attack can be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is required for a successful exploitation. Successful exploitation requires user interaction by the victim. The technical details are unknown and an exploit is not available.

It is declared as proof-of-concept. As 0-day the estimated underground price was around $25k-$100k.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 21210 (MS06-013: Cumulative Security Update for Internet Explorer (912812)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family Windows : Microsoft Bulletins. The commercial vulnerability scanner Qualys is able to test this issue with plugin 100034 (Microsoft Internet Explorer Cumulative Security Update Missing (MS06-013)).

Applying a patch is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at windowsupdate.microsoft.com. The problem might be mitigated by replacing the product with as an alternative.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be establishing an alternative product.

The vulnerability is also documented in the databases at X-Force (25394), Tenable (21210), SecurityFocus (BID 17181†), OSVDB (24095†) and Secunia (SA19378†).
